Working with AI forces multitasking and kills flow, developer argues
_akpiper · x · 2026-09-06
Developer akpiper points out a counterintuitive problem: it's unclear how to work with AI without multitasking. While the agent runs, you sit waiting—your options are meditating, scrolling social media, stretching, or switching tasks, none of which equals flow. AI productivity gains come with a new attention-management cost.
